Skip to content

Commit

Permalink
Feature changes 4.0.0
Browse files Browse the repository at this point in the history
* added inverted range check for climate extremes
* added option to redistribure condtion IDs
* updated german translations
* updated metadata
* moved scaling of Biome filters to a filter option
* moved Nether and End biome filters to the Biome category
* enabled Voronoi biome filters (use only when neccessary)
* removed Triggers tab, since the Locations tab includes its functionality
  • Loading branch information
Cubitect committed Jan 28, 2024
1 parent fa28986 commit 0b03cac
Show file tree
Hide file tree
Showing 35 changed files with 1,625 additions and 1,613 deletions.
15 changes: 7 additions & 8 deletions .github/workflows/windows-release.yaml
Original file line number Diff line number Diff line change
Expand Up @@ -3,18 +3,19 @@ name: Windows Release
on:
push:
branches:
- 'main'
- 'trunk'
tags:
- 'v*'

defaults:
run:
shell: cmd

env:
PROG: cubiomes-viewer
SOURCE_DIR: ${{github.workspace}}

defaults:
run:
shell: cmd
working-directory: ${{env.SOURCE_DIR}}

jobs:
build:
runs-on: windows-2019
Expand All @@ -26,7 +27,6 @@ jobs:
submodules: recursive

- name: (2) Get all tags for correct version determination
working-directory: ${{env.SOURCE_DIR}}
run: |
git fetch --all --tags -f
Expand All @@ -43,13 +43,11 @@ jobs:
setup-python: false

- name: (4) Build
working-directory: ${{env.SOURCE_DIR}}
run: |
qmake CONFIG+=release ${{env.SOURCE_DIR}}
mingw32-make
- name: (5) Deploy
working-directory: ${{env.SOURCE_DIR}}
run: |
mkdir ${{env.PROG}}
copy ${{env.SOURCE_DIR}}\release\${{env.PROG}}.exe ${{env.PROG}}
Expand All @@ -61,3 +59,4 @@ jobs:
name: ${{env.PROG}}-${{github.ref_name}}-win
path: ${{env.SOURCE_DIR}}\${{env.PROG}}


2 changes: 1 addition & 1 deletion cubiomes
Submodule cubiomes updated 3 files
+0 −5 biomes.h
+77 −22 noise.c
+4 −1 noise.h
Empty file modified etc/com.github.cubitect.cubiomes-viewer.desktop
100755 → 100644
Empty file.
10 changes: 7 additions & 3 deletions etc/com.github.cubitect.cubiomes-viewer.metainfo.xml
Original file line number Diff line number Diff line change
Expand Up @@ -16,15 +16,19 @@
<release version="4.0.0" date="2024-01-??">
<description>
<p>This release adds a way to find locations in a given seed, as well as a biome sample filter that can check biome proportions.</p>
<p>All scaled coordinates have been changed to use block coordinates instead. Scaled iterators now have scaling option.</p>
<p>All scaled coordinates have been changed to use block coordinates instead. Scaled biome filters and iterators now have a scaling option.</p>
<p>Changes:</p>
<ul>
<li>Added Locations tab to look for position in the current seed</li>
<li>Added biome samples filter to check biome proportions</li>
<li>Added filter for Biome Samples to check biome proportions</li>
<li>Added outline display for the area of selected conditions</li>
<li>Added "from-visible" to conditions editor</li>
<li>Added headless mode to search seeds without a GUI using --nogui</li>
<li>Removed Triggers tab, since the Locations tab replaces the functionality</li>
<li>Moved scaling of Biome filters to a filter option</li>
<li>Moved step size of Iterators to a filter option</li>
<li>Moved Nether and End biome filters to the Biome category</li>
<li>Enabled Voronoi biome filters (use only when neccessary)</li>
<li>Removed Triggers tab, since the Locations tab includes its functionality</li>
</ul>
</description>
</release>
Expand Down
355 changes: 28 additions & 327 deletions etc/icon.svg
Loading
Sorry, something went wrong. Reload?
Sorry, we cannot display this file.
Sorry, this file is invalid so it cannot be displayed.
1 change: 0 additions & 1 deletion rc/examples.qrc
Original file line number Diff line number Diff line change
Expand Up @@ -5,7 +5,6 @@
<file>examples/mushroom_icespike.txt</file>
<file>examples/biome_diversity_1_18.txt</file>
<file>examples/old_growth_taiga_somewhere.txt</file>
<file>examples/large_birch_forest_1_18.txt</file>
<file>examples/huge_jungle_1_18.txt</file>
<file>examples/portal_village_or_treasure.txt</file>
<file>examples/two_zombie_villages.txt</file>
Expand Down
11 changes: 5 additions & 6 deletions rc/examples/quadhut_stronghold_mushroom.txt
Original file line number Diff line number Diff line change
@@ -1,7 +1,6 @@
#Version: 2.0.0
#Version: 4.0.0
#Mode48: 0
#HutQual: 0
#Cond: 01000000fdfffffffdffffff020000000200000001000000000000000000000000000000000000000000000000000000000000000000000000000000000000000000000000000000000000000000000000000000000000000000000000000000000000000000000000000000000000000000000000000000000000000000000000000000000000000000000000000000000000000000000000000000000000000000000000000000000000000000000000000000010000003f0000000000000000000000000000000000000000000000000000000000000000000000000000000000000000000000000000000000000000000000000000000000000000000000000000000000000000000000000000000000000000000000000000000000000000000000000000000000000000000000
#Cond: 1300000000ffffff00ffffff000100000001000002000000010000000000000000000000000000000000000000000000000000000000000000000000000000000000000000000000000000000000000000000000000000000000000000000000000000000000000000000000000000000000000000000000000000000000000000000000000000000000000000000000000000000000000000000000000000000000000000000000000000000000000000000000040000003f0000000000000000000000000000000000000000000000000000000000000000000000000000000000000000000000000000000000000000000000000000000000000000000000000000000000000000000000000000000000000000000000000000000000000000000000000000000000000000000000
#Cond: 370000000000000000000000000000000000000003000000010000000000000000000000000000000000000000000000000000000000000000000000000000000000000000000000000000000000000000000000000000000000000000000000000000000000000000000000000000000000000000000000000000000000000000000000000000000000000000000000000000000000000000000000000000000000000000000000000000000000000000000000010000003f0000000000000091010000000000000000000000000000000000000000000000000000000000000000000000000000000000000000000000000000000000000000000000000000000000000000000000000000000000000000000000000000000000000000000000000000000000000000000000000000
#Cond: 0b000000fdfffffffdffffff020000000200000004000000010000000000000001000000000000000000000000000000004000000000000000000000000000000040000000000000000000000000000000400000000000000000000000000000004000000000000000000000000000000000000000000000000000000000000000000000000000000000000000000000000000000000000000000000000000000000000000000000000000000000000000000000010000003f0000000000000000000000000000000000000000000000000000000000000000000000000000000000000000000000000000000000000000000000000000000000000000000000000000000000000000000000000000000000000000000000000000000000000000000000000000000000000000000000
#Cond: 0100000000faffff00faffffff050000ff050000010000000000000000000000000000000000000000000000000000000000000000000000000000000000000000000000000000000000000000000000000000000000000000000000000000000000000000000000000000000000000000000000000000000000000000000400000000000000000000000000000000000000000000000000000000000000000000000000000000000000000000000000000000000100000000010000200000000000000000000000000000000000000000000080ffffff7f00000080ffffff7f00000080ffffff7f00000080ffffff7f00000080ffffff7f00000080ffffff7f00000080ffffff7f00000080ffffff7f00000080ffffff7f00000080ffffff7f00000080ffffff7f00000080ffffff7f00000000000000000000000000000000
#Cond: 1300000000000000000000000000000000000000020000000100000000000000000000000000000000000000000000000000000000000000000000000000000000000000000000000000000000000000000000000000000000000000000000000000000000000000000000000000000000000000000000000000000000000400000000000000000000000000000000000000000000000000000000000000000000000000000000000000000000000000000000000400000000000000000000000001000000000000000000000000000000000000000000000000000000000000000000000000000000000000000000000000000000000000000000000000000000000000000000000000000000000000000000000000000000000000000000000000000000000000000000000000000000000000000000000000000000000000
#Cond: 370000000000000000000000000000000000000003000000010000000000000000000000000000000000000000000000000000000000000000000000000000000000000000000000000000000000000000000000000000000000000000000000000000000000000000000000000000000000000000000000000000000000040000000000000000000000000000000000000000000000000000000000000000000000000000000000000000000000000000000000010000003f000000000000009101000000000000000000000000000000000000000000000000000000000000000000000000000000000000000000000000000000000000000000000000000000000000000000000000000000000000000000000000000000000000000000000000000000000000000000000000000000000000000000000000000000000000
#Cond: 0700000000fdffff00fdffffff020000ff02000004000000010000000000000000000000000000000000000000000000000000000000000000000000000000000000000000000000000000000000000000000000000000000000000000000000004000000000000000000000000000000000000000000000000000000001040000000000000000000000000000000000000000000000000000000000000000000000000000000000000000000000000000000000010000003f000000000000000000000000000000000000000000000000000080ffffff7f00000080ffffff7f00000080ffffff7f00000080ffffff7f00000080ffffff7f00000080ffffff7f00000080ffffff7f00000080ffffff7f00000080ffffff7f00000080ffffff7f00000080ffffff7f00000080ffffff7f00000000000000000000000000000000
Binary file modified rc/icons/logo.png
Loading
Sorry, something went wrong. Reload?
Sorry, we cannot display this file.
Sorry, this file is invalid so it cannot be displayed.
Binary file modified rc/lang/de_DE.qm
Binary file not shown.
Loading

0 comments on commit 0b03cac

Please sign in to comment.